Curve is a decentralized exchange for stablecoins that uses an Automated Market Maker (AMM) to manage liquidity. It is now synonymous with the decentralized finance (DeFi) phenomenon and has seen significant growth in the second half of 2020.

While it is not necessary to hold PUMP in order to access or use these protocols—which are fully permissionless—holders may enjoy community-driven features, such as promotional giveaways. As the utility coin associated with the Pump.fun brand, PUMP enhances the ecosystem's identity and encourages engagement across its various protocols.
